#15e089 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#15e089 is composed of 8.2% red, 87.8%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.8%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 154.3 degrees, a saturation of 82.9% and a lightness of 48%. #15e089 color hex could be obtained by blending #2affff with #00c113.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

Shades and Tints of #15e089

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010905 is the darkest color, while #f6fef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#15e089

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#73827c is the less saturated color, while #02f38c is the most saturated one.
